From ac18d660ebadf24f453867ec63573e6b37e5801a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Scott Rifenbark Date: Wed, 6 Mar 2013 10:26:55 -0800 Subject: dev-manual: Added notes about creating your own distro Added a couple of notes to point out the ease of creating your own distro and not just relying on a Poky distribution. One note is at the very beginning of the manual and mentions Angstrom as an example of a distro based on the YP. The other note is at the beginning of the second chapter.
